Anyone hoping to walk through the river walk to the cruise terminal beware!!! Only ncl and royal Caribbean have elevators to the ground floor of their terminal. Carnival must go out on the balcony and walk way down towards the ship only to find out there are 3 flights of steps to go down to the terminal. No way could we handle that with luggage. It's really sad the port doesn't have a way for carnival cruise passengers to get to the ground level. We had to turn around and go back to the river walk and exit through the food court. We had to get a taxi since it was raining and we had to pay $14.00 to go behind the convention center.

Many, many posts on here recommending that everyone take a cab. Too many issues with trying to walk unless yours is the only ship in that day. Even then, weather, walking in the traffic zones and the crush of passengers makes it iffy. A $9 cab ride fixes everything!
